Te Wiki o Te Reo Māori 2014Te kupu o te wiki
Using this resource1. Each slide has one word from the Kupu o te Wiki list for Te Wiki o te Reo Māori.2. The picture will come up first followed by the Māori word. The English word appears
as well in some of the slides. There is an example of how to use the word in a sentence on every slide.
3. Introduce 1 word a week. Bring up the picture and ask your class what the word is. This could be done during form class time across the school.
4. Every time you introduce a new word, review previous words that you have learnt. 5. Print these slides out as flash cards. The print function in Powerpoint will allow up to
9 slides per page.6. Email this presentation to everybody in the school and make it available on your
school website. 7. Set up inter-class or inter-department competitions using the words in a quiz game
format. 8. As you walk around the school, ask students what the kupu o te wiki is and its
translation. If they get it right they get a small prize. 9. Use your imagination e hoa mā. Kia kaha!
